摘要
通过计算多风机通风系统中每个风机的主要作用范围,将系统中的巷道划分成若干个以风机为代表的分区,给出将分区转变成多个相互连接的“鸭蛋”形曲线网络图的方法,并进行了编程实现,通过实例应用表明生成的网络图分支交叉少,主要用风巷道突出。
In a ventilation system, each main fan always has an area mainly controlled by the fan. If the most of flow of one laneway flows into air through one main fan, the laneway should belong to the area controlled by the main fan. The key work of this paper is to calculate these areas and put each area into one curved network diagraph Software based on this theory has been developed and applied in some design department and coal mines.
